Credit notes and invoice disputes
If a charge on your invoice looks wrong, raise it with Finance in writing. emnify issues any resulting correction as a credit note.
Dispute an invoice
Send an email to finance@emnify.com with a full overview of what you believe is incorrect and why, so that Finance can investigate.
Under Clause 6.7 of the emnify Terms of Sale, objections must be:
- Raised in good faith
- Made in writing and substantiated
- Submitted within 30 calendar days of receiving the invoice
You can withhold payment only for the disputed portion of the invoice.
If your question is why usage is higher than expected, rather than whether the invoice is correct, start with Reports. Usage history and Usage per device often explain a spike without a dispute.
To ask whether collection activities can be paused while a dispute is investigated, contact your Account Manager. See Collections during a dispute.
Credit notes
emnify generates credit notes with the billing cycle, once a month, at the beginning of the following month.
Credit notes in the emnify Portal
Standalone credit notes aren’t shown in the emnify Portal.
Contact finance@emnify.com for the document.
Offset a credit note against future invoices
Contact finance@emnify.com to have a credit note offset against future invoices, so that Finance can set up the offset in the emnify accounting system.
